I was busy this weekend so not much tractor use but I am looking to get a finish mower soon so I can be ready for mowing season to start! I'm not sure if I should get a 60" or a 72" lol

What kind of area are you going to cut? Also if you put your location (general) it would help others answer your questions. I would go with the 72" if it were me, but what I cut is usually very dry and thin. Damp, moist or thick grass, maybe go with the 60", wouldn't bog down the tractor as much. I have a 72" RFM that I use on my little MT125 without any problems.
